Undergraduate Data Processing Degrees at YVC

The table below lists every degree level granted in data processing at YVC, along with how many graduates complete each level annually.

Degree Level Annual Graduates
Associate’s 4
Certificate 1

YVC Data Processing Associate’s Degrees

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, Yakima Valley College conferred 4 associate’s degrees in data processing.

YVC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

$5,312 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

Information about average full-time undergraduate tuition and fees is shown in the table below.

In State Out of State
Tuition $4,343 $5,333
Fees $540 $540
